Just for a bit of general information, it might be worth mentioning that some of the palette entries are used for colour cycling. For example the radar pings on the intercept console. That's achieved by shifting a whole block of palette entries to give the effect of movement. (Think KITT's chasing lights) The image doesn't change, but the colour that you see does. It results in a wave movement. If anyone remembers the shifting colours on ye olde Windows startup screens, this was achieved in the same way.

Other palette swaps include the greyscale background bitmaps that are used in the Geoscape screens. They keep the same palette entry, and the game only needs to shift these entries to different shades to change the shades of the backgrounds.

Also another random technical tidbit, the game uses mode 13h for its display. In other words 320x200x256clr VGA mode. It used to come standard on all SVGA cards as a safe mode to revert to. The first fifteen colours after the transparency were probably left behind for use by the console. They appear to match the old text mode 16 colour palette.
